Pair Trading with BCE and Kinaxis
The main advantage of trading using opposite BCE and Kinaxis posit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if BCE position performs unexpectedly, Kinaxis can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Kinaxis will offset losses from the drop in Kinaxis' long position.The idea behind BCE Inc and Kinaxis p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
